Output 423e3b6500b57a29e175fa4d804ea85185bd7a2955baf3021aee5eb9e9833978:1

value
13989066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3efb42d9767e5989ef8d206823b161bd3d1d4bd OP_EQUAL
address
ADDVCrBERdwx2RpXyU2pHE3oKKA7aruk6S
transaction
423e3b6500b57a29e175fa4d804ea85185bd7a2955baf3021aee5eb9e9833978